Oregon City School District provides every student free access to Sora, a digital library app designed specifically for K–12 learners. Whether your student is a confident reader, still building their skills, or somewhere in between, Sora has something for them — and the tools to help them grow.
Here's what's waiting for your family
📚 A library built for them: Ebooks, audiobooks, picture books, read-alongs, and graphic novels — all hand-selected and age-appropriate for all our readers.
🏠 Access anywhere, anytime: Sora works on phones, tablets, and computers. Books are available 24/7 — no library hours, no late fees, no lost books.
🌎 Books in their language: The app is available in 13 languages and includes bilingual titles and world language books, so every family can engage with reading in the language that works best for them.
👁️ Built for every kind of reader: Adjustable text size, dyslexic-friendly fonts, high contrast display, and a read-aloud feature that highlights words as they're spoken — Sora meets your student where they are.
🏅 Motivation built in: Daily reading goals, progress tracking, and achievement badges make reading fun and engaging!
🏙️ Two libraries in one: Through our partnership with Oregon City Public Library, your student's student library card also unlocks OCPL's digital collection inside Sora — even more books, same app, no extra steps.

Families interested in a Spanish–English dual language immersion experience for their child are invited to learn more about our program ¡Todos Unidos!, offered through the Oregon City School District.
¡Todos Unidos! is a K–12 pathway that begins at Candy Lane Elementary, where students learn to read, write, speak, and listen in both Spanish and English while meeting grade-level academic standards. The program supports strong academics, cultural understanding, and bilingualism from an early age.
📝 Enrollment for kindergarten and first grade is through a lottery.
Families who are interested must enter the lottery to be considered for placement. Our lottery is now open and will run through April 1, so don't wait!
